Another website that uses social networking for good is www.Firstgiving.com. Firstgiving create a free personalized online fundraising page for an non-profit registered with GuideStar, a national registry of nearly 2MM non-profits. You simply create a page, personalize it, and then send the link to all your friends via email or post a widget in your blog space.

What makes Firstgiving stand out is that they directly transfer the funds to the non-profit and so no one has to worry about where the funds go or register for a paypal account.
